John Singleton drops out of Tupac biopic

John Singleton has decided against directing the Tupac biopic. Slashfilm reports (via Shadow and Act) that Singleton has dropped out of his talks to direct the project. Antoine Fuqua was first attached to direct, but left because finding someone to play the lead role fo Shakur proved to be very difficult.

No news is available on why he dropped out at this time. Singleton has decided to focus his efforts on an untitled love story that reunites him with Baby Boy stars Tyrese Gibson and Taraji P. Henson. The Boyz in the Hood director seemed like a perfect fit for the job, especially since he had formed a friendship with the rapper-actor during the filming of Poetic Justice.

Very few details are known about the new project. It is described as "a crazy, dysfunctional love story set in the ‘hood.” Singleton will be directing from his own original script. One thing is for sure, the film is not planned as a sequel to Baby Boy, despite the involvement of Gibson and Henson.
